Undervoltage protection (V
u
)
The undervoltage protection responds with a denable denite-time delayt
u
(U) as soon as a
phase-to-phase voltage (U
ph
-U
ph
) falls below the operating valueU
u
.
The operating value is described as factor <1 of the rated voltage U
n
of the power system.
The rated voltage U
n
can be variably set from 100V to 690V.
In this way, the distribution board can be protected from impermissible deviations in the line
voltage.
Overvoltage protection (V
o
)
The overvoltage protection responds with a denable denite-time delayt
o
(U) as soon as a
phase-to-phase voltage(U
ph
-U
ph
) rises above the operating valueU
o
.
The operating value is described as factor >1 of the rated voltage U
n
of the power system.
The rated voltage U
n
can be variably set from 100V to 690V.
In this way, the distribution board can be protected from impermissible deviations in the line
voltage.
2.9.4.1 Characteristic curves
The settings selected for the trip unit of a circuit breaker depend on the technical environment
(e.g. switchboard and applications) and the type of equipment to be protected. It is the
responsibility of the system planner to calculate and dimension the protection settings in
accordance with the valid rules.
